Swing gates are the most common in the world, simple and reliable mechanism movable barrier. It is not difficult to weld a gate correctly: the design of two leaves has been proven for hundreds of years. “In-place” technology is traditional for fencing of this type.

To weld a garage door correctly, you need to choose its type, type, and size before starting construction.

The dimensions of the garage enclosing structure are calculated based on the type vehicle. The dimensions of the existing car (they are measured along the edge of the mirrors) are increased to the dimensions expected in the future. To the resulting value add:

  • 0.6 m – if the car moves straight when entering the garage;
  • 1.0 m – if entering from a turn.

Approximately for passenger cars the width of the alignment is 2.4-2.5 m; for SUVs, it is necessary to provide a width of 3-3.5 m. The height of the opening is designed within the range: 2-2.2 m.

Selection of frame design and drawing

The box consists of two frames connected by jumpers. The design of the frame (shown in the photo) resembles a ring with concave edges, which covers the ends of the walls along the entire perimeter of the frame along the ribs. First frame – external frame- made from a corner, directed by the shelves inside the garage. When assembling the second frame - the internal frame, the corner is laid with shelves outward.

The box parts must be butt welded. In this case, the corner flanges at the junction are cut at an angle of 45°. The shorter length of each corner should be equal to the distance between the opposite edges of the wall minus 10mm. This centimeter technological gap(2x5 mm), it is necessary for ease of frame installation. Thus, the internal width of the garage opening inside the box will be equal to:

  • The width between the ends of the walls is 10 mm (double the technological gap) - 16 mm (double the thickness of the corner shelves).

  • The width of the frame made of profile pipes should be 20 mm smaller than the openings between the frames (quadruple the gap): it is necessary for the free movement of the sashes.
  • The length of the vertical guide is equal to this distance; the lengths of the horizontal ribs are reduced by 80 mm: by two thicknesses of the vertical pipes.

Assembly and welding

Watch the video on how to weld gates.

The box is laid out on the technological table. It consists of four support platforms installed in the corners of the structure at the same height. You can use brick or cinder block as platforms. Before starting welding:

  • The mating corners are laid out taking into account the level and equality of the diagonals:
  • fastened with clamps;
  • “grab” with dots;
  • joints are corrected;
  • weld;
  • measure the diagonals.

The difference between them should not exceed 5 mm.

The operation is repeated for the second box. Using the method shown in the video, the frame of the valves is welded from profile pipes.

The fastening of the panels to the frame made of profile pipes is carried out by welding every 100 - 150 mm. The right blade is made wider than the left one by 20-50 mm.

The hinges are attached in the following way: the sashes are inserted into the opening and adjusted in height and level. The movement step is 5 mm. This is enough to correct a minor technological error: the free movement of the blade vertically in accordance with the drawing is 20 mm.

Garage hinges are welded in this way: the lower half (with the support rod) is welded to the frame, and the upper half is welded to the movable leaf. After the final adjustment of the enclosing mechanism, the fastening of the hinges is reinforced with steel plates, which are scalded around the perimeter. The box is attached to the slopes with metal rods with a length of 150 mm.

The initial stage is framing the opening

At this stage, it is important to correctly cut and weld the corners into a single structure - a frame, which will support the outward opening doors. Framing work begins at the threshold of the garage and is carried out in the following order:

  1. Cut 2 corners the width of the opening and lay them along the threshold on both sides. Weld them with steel strips (ties).
  2. Cut off 4 more side corners with your own hands, whose length is equal to the height of the opening plus 2 widths of their shelves. The resulting racks must be cut at both ends so that they clearly fit into the corners of the threshold.
  3. Attach the racks to the side ends of the walls and connect them together using ties. The latter must be placed opposite the joint welding points.
  4. Weld the frame of the threshold and walls together.
  5. Repeat the action described in step 1, only install the corners on the upper end of the wall. Weld them to the side posts.

During the work, it is necessary to ensure that the framing elements fit as tightly as possible to the walls. Steel tie strips must be laid between the corner flanges and the wall, and then welded.


The first stage is making the frame

Manufacturing of sashes

The essence of the method is that first, one solid sash is made directly in the opening and attached on both sides with hinges. The result is a frame inserted into a frame, which is finally cut in half. In order for future gates to open well, it is important to properly maintain the gaps between these frames:

  • from the ceiling beam to the sash frame - 1 cm;
  • the gap between the side post and the same frame is 5 mm;
  • the lower gap above the threshold is 2 cm.

The process begins with the installation of the side frame posts and is carried out in this order:

  1. The corner, cut taking into account the upper and lower gap, must be placed on the side frame with a gap of 5 mm and secured to it using a piece of metal. Repeat the operation on the other side end.
  2. Weld the horizontal corners from the bottom and top to the vertical posts, cutting them properly. Before this, you need to make a slot for one shelf with your own hands exactly in the middle of each jumper.
  3. Install the canopies and weld their lower part to the frame, and the upper part to the sash frame. The hinge should be opposite the connection connecting the internal and outer part gate frames.
  4. Place 2 vertical posts in the middle of the opening, securing them to the frame by welding.
  5. Make 2 horizontal lintels exactly in the middle of each sash.

The resulting frame, built into the frame of the opening, remains to be cut into 2 parts, which open independently thanks to hinges. Considering that the shelves of the upper and lower corners are already trimmed, you just need to cut them from the front side.

To prevent gates without leaves from immediately sagging under their own weight, temporary braces should be installed from the inside and secured by welding. Then, using a grinder, you need to remove the potholders holding the side corners, after which the doors can be opened.

On last stage You need to cut and weld the leaves to the garage door with your own hands. When closed, they should overlap the frame by about half, which is how you need to cut the sheet of metal. Then weld it to the frame and remove the braces. All that remains is to install the lock and latches, and then clean and paint the gate.

There are several main garage door designs:

  1. Recoil.
    The mechanism of action is similar to sliding wardrobes. Convenient and practical option, but there is an important nuance - in the direction of opening the gate it is necessary to provide space, and of the same length as the gate leaf.
  2. Roller shutters.
    A special box is installed under the garage ceiling, into which the canvas plates are removed. It is worth noting immediately that despite high convenience, this design Gates are the worst protected from intrusion, so they should only be installed in protected areas.
  3. Sectional.
    The design consists of a canvas divided into sections. When folded, the gate leaves are refracted, and with the help of a special spring mechanism and profile system rise to the ceiling. The main advantage of this design is good tightness and space saving.
  4. Lift-and-swivel.
    When opened, the door leaf rises vertically to the ceiling using a lever-hinged mechanism. Gates of this type are quite practical, easy to use and save space both inside and in front of the garage.
  5. Swing.
    The oldest and most popular type of gate. They are extremely popular due to their convenient and simple design, consisting of two doors, as well as their low cost. Even a novice welder can weld swing garage doors with his own hands.

Manufacturing of the supporting frame

Everything you need has been collected, the place has been prepared - you can figure out how to weld a garage door. The first thing that needs to be done is the strapping along the opening, or the supporting frame. It consists of two main parts - the internal and external frame.

  1. We measure the height and width of the opening.
    The measurements must be as accurate as possible, since the installation of the finished frame completely depends on them.
  2. Blanks for the future frame are measured from the corner and cut with a grinder.
  3. The finished workpieces are laid out on the prepared surface, using linings they are clearly leveled, all corners are leveled.
    The resulting result should completely replicate the future frame.
  4. We weld the frame.
    To ensure the best fit in the future, it outer side should be even and smooth, without roughness and bumps, so all welding jambs are carefully ground.
  5. Levers are welded into the corners (you can use pieces of angle iron).
    They will provide the finished frame with spatial rigidity, and it will not move.
  6. We lay out all the elements on a plane, level them and secure them by welding.
  7. Let's try it on.
    We correct all discrepancies with a hammer and fully weld
  8. We make the second frame similarly to the first.
  9. The inner and upper parts of the frame are installed in place.
    For fastening to the opening slopes it is convenient to use 15-20 centimeter metal pins.
  10. All protruding ends are cut off, thoroughly scalded and thoroughly sanded.
  11. To fasten the frames to each other, metal plates are used, which are welded at a distance of approximately 50-60 centimeters from one another.
  12. This stage is completed by hanging the sash.

Gate trim

Gate trim is a stage of work during which it is important to do everything efficiently, since not only will directly depend on this appearance design, but also its functionality.

When welding, follow the following procedure:

  1. We cut the sheets of galvanized iron to the size of the sashes.
    Do not forget to take into account that the left sash leaf should be several centimeters wider and overlap the profile of the right sash.
  2. The sheet of metal is immediately welded to the frame at several points.
  3. The sheathing of the right side of the structure is cut taking into account the two centimeters indicated above.
    That is, the edge of the metal sheet does not reach the edge of the profile by the specified distance.
  4. Let's start welding work.
    It is important to immediately grab the sheet of metal at the corners and in the center so that it does not move anywhere, since otherwise one of the corners may bend outward. This is not fatal, and can be corrected with a sledgehammer, but it’s easier to do everything right away efficiently.
  5. Welding is done not in one continuous seam, but in spots.
    Otherwise, the gate leaves may move. If you want to cook solidly, then using clamps you need to press the frame tightly against the channel with clamps and cook in stages of about 10 centimeters. It is important to do it on the other side each time to avoid overheating of the metal.

Insulation

The final stage of work is insulation. Thanks to it, in winter it will be possible to retain more than 60 percent of the heat indoors.

For insulation on inner surface We install a wooden sheathing on the sashes, inside of which a layer of insulation is laid. For high-quality insulation Mineral wool, glass wool, and polystyrene foam PSB-S are well suited.

It is especially important to avoid the presence of air bags and to carefully fill all gaps. For normal heat retention, a layer of about 5 centimeters is enough. Cladding slabs or lining are installed on top of the sheathing. Also, if desired, you can hang a plastic or tarpaulin canopy from the inside.

Painting and insulation

Metal gates must be painted and primed. It is advisable to renew the paint every two years. Important nuances Things to remember when painting gates:

  • degrease surfaces with solvent;
  • treat with a metal primer with an anti-rust additive;
  • we paint, it is more convenient to paint metal from a special apparatus in which the paint is applied under pressure. In this case, the paint consumption is less and the coating performance is higher. The device can be rented, as it is not cheap.

After painting, we proceed to insulating the gates, because metal is the best conductor of cold:

  • it is more convenient to lay the insulation along wooden sheathing on the gate leaf, which is mounted from the inside;
  • Expanded polystyrene can be used as insulation, but in this case it will be necessary to protect the insulation with non-combustible finishing sheathing. It is better to choose glass wool in mats or mineral wool– it is a non-flammable material;
  • Additionally, all the cracks that remain around the perimeter of the frame installation must be foamed polyurethane foam, then cut off the excess foam and plaster;
  • it is important to fill all voids with insulation so that cold bridges do not form;
  • for middle latitudes, where there is no severe frost, the insulation layer is 5 cm, for the north - not lower than 10 - 15 cm.

The finishing of the gate from the inside along the wooden lathing is made from plastic lining or plywood.
